
Demolition on the golf course lake is nearly complete and reconstruction will start next week. Once complete, the once badly leaking lake will run more efficiently, saving the POA more than $80,000 in water each year.
The lake, which was last modified in the 1980s, is being reconfigured with natural sloping sides, a new liner, and a new earthen bridge. The new lake will be slightly smaller than the previous lake.
In September 2019, the POA Board of Directors approved funding in the amount of $359,896.51 from the Repair and Replacement Fund for the renovation of the lake.
